Foreword often overlooked, aungier street is one of the great neighbourhoods in the historic core of dublin and has a fascinating history. Francis aungier, 1st baron aungier of longford 15581632, also known as lord aungier, was the progenitor of the earldom of longford, member of the house of lords, privy councillor for ireland, and master of the rolls in ireland under james i and charles i. Number 99a aungier street, which celebrates its 350th birthday this year, is considered the oldest, most intact domestic building in the city. It is one of the first buildings erected in the aungier estate, dublins first planned development, predating the construction of georgian dublin.

History of the stone underneath dit aungier street by josephine gallagher february 21, 20. Yes, commuters were very happy this morning when they embarked on a new deli situated on aungier street. Many of these large 17th century houses survive today on aungier street. Peters church was a former church of ireland parish church located in aungier street in dublin, ireland, where the dublin ymca building now stands. Aungier street was the main route for british troops and auxiliaries making their way from portobello barracks to dublin castle and because of this, it was one of the main sites of ira attacks this tends to back up the view that this was a political confrontation the british could not win.
